The Service Coordinator is a key liaison between our customers and our Service Technicians, ensuring that we deliver exceptional service at every interaction, both internally and externally. Based in Fort McMurray and reporting to the Service Administration Manager, you will use your customer service, administrative, scheduling, and organizational skills to partner jointly with customers and Levitt-Safety service technicians to facilitate the efficient and thorough completion and documentation of each service job from customer contact through final invoicing, ultimately providing an exceptional customer service experience at all touchpoints. Main Responsibilities * Provide exceptional customer service to our service customers and technicians regarding diverse aspects of our products and services. * Determine service requirements and schedule/dispatch technicians for service calls to meet customer needs * Work closely with the service technicians and the customer to coordinate tools, equipment and subcontracts required for each service call * Maintain accurate records including calendar management, customer accounts, work orders, purchase orders, inventory management, and other documentation required for each service call and branch support * Ensure that all invoicing is processed accurately according to work performed, including capturing customer payment methods and updating information in customer portals as required to ensure prompt receipt of payment * Participate in internal projects and tasks as required to help us make Canada a safer place to live and work. * Other duties as they pertain to this role. Skills * Prior experience in a service advisor, customer service and/or coordinating role in an industrial or technical business-to-business environment, ideally working with technicians and service scheduling * Experience in scheduling and/or dispatching field service technicians or equivalent is a strong asset * Strong customer service and communication skills, both verbal and written, able to work effectively with both internal and external customers * Strong organizational and computer skills, able to use multiple systems effectively to keep up with concurrent priorities * Highly detail-oriented with exceptional administrative skills; passionate about making quality personal * Able to lift up to 50 lbs. and to move skids (with proper equipment and training) * An exceptional willingness to learn and a can-do positive attitude will help Keep Things Fun on the team.
